Abstract

The utility model belongs to the technical field of railway construction monitoring, and discloses an intelligent rail flaw detection combination vehicle, which realizes self-walking, high precision, easy operation and remote control by applying the technology of Internet of things and the modern control technology; the railway fault detection of the large flaw detection vehicle is completed in an auxiliary mode; intelligent unmanned operation, self-walking, recording and real-time transmission of damage, mileage and line characteristic signals are realized; the computer is used to process and record the obtained flaw detection signal to realize non-rise and fall or automatic rise and fall. The utility model discloses be provided with detection and two function module of automated inspection that someone participated in, use internet of things and modern control technology can realize from walking, high accuracy, easy operation and remote control. Meanwhile, the industrial design elements are designed; the railway fault detection device can assist in completing railway fault detection of a large flaw detection vehicle, can completely replace railway maintenance tasks of hand-push type flaw detection equipment, and can better meet the requirements of rail flaw detection.

Background technique
Currently, the prior art commonly used in the trade is such that
Country's outer rail non-destructive testing at present has that high sensitivity, speed be fast, cost all based on ultrasonic examination technology Low, harmless advantage can carry out orientational and quantificational detection to defect.Current existing equipment includes large-scale track flaw detection Vehicle, Mini-railway inspection car and small push rail detector car are all to carry out rail defects and failures detection using ultrasonic wave.
With China's rapid development of economy, the important function of railway and rail traffic is increasingly highlighted, and rail once goes out It is now unexpected to generate destructive result and immeasurable loss.Train operation process can to rail generate friction, Extruding, bending and percussion, make track the damage of various kinds occur, lead to the different kinds of railways accident such as brittle fractures of rail.To railway It is to guarantee the important measures of rail safety operation that track, which carries out real-time hurt detection,.
The hand propelled rail-defect detector car of China's main railway defect-detecting equipment at present, small push inspection car penetration capacity By force, detection sensitivity is good, while having higher recall rate, but detects a flaw inefficiency and the very big manpower of needs consuming, flaw detection knot Fruit can also be influenced by human factors such as experience, the operating habits of operator.And large-scale inspection car is multiple functional, detection speed The advantages that rate is high, and the accuracy of monitoring is good, data can handle in real time, can also be stored and be played back.But large-scale ultrasonic steel Rail inspection car detection environment limited resource is more, generally requires the smooth cleaning of rail level and detection mode is the track of off-line type Detection.Miniature hand pulling type defect-detecting equipment detection rates bottom is not able to satisfy capable railway flaw detection demand;And large-scale inspection car is not yet Realize nationalization production, and technology is monopolized by foreign countries, and expensive price is subject to certain restrictions configuration quantity, carries out effective work It makes comparisons difficulty.
In conclusion problem of the existing technology is:
(1) small push inspection car can only meet that basic detection function, detection efficiency be low, small scale, can not carry The functional component of operator, carrying are exposed, and staff is easy fatigue, are not able to satisfy existing railway flaw detection demand.
(2) Mini-railway inspection car may be implemented manned and unmanned, but current equipment whole design letter It is plain, lack the sense of security, it is man-machine that overall dimensions, structure and function combine unreasonable, Work seat not meet, and is easy to produce fatigue Sense is unable to satisfy the demand for carrying precision instrument and the comfortable working environment of staff.
(3) multiple functions such as large-scale inspection car collection flaw detection, railroad maintenance, maintenance, the scale of construction is larger, detects environment limited resource It is more, it generally requires the smooth cleaning of rail level and detection mode is the track detecting of off-line type.

The utility model is further described below with reference to concrete analysis.
One: two vehicle of working method is applied in combination
Using modularized design, an orbital maintenance vehicle and a unmanned smart flaw detection vehicle are designed.Two Che Jike with Be used alone, can also two vehicles merge uses, intelligent vehicle detect a flaw while can repair in real time, by rail Flaw detection and maintenance two work and meanwhile carry out, greatly improve the efficiency of maintenance;Front truck draws rear car and moves ahead, and reduces The consumption of the energy, meets Green design concept.
During two vehicles are applied in combination, front truck draw wait it is forward, when rear car detect railway damage will will be damaged Specifying information be sent to front truck after computer is analyzed, front truck service personnel utilizes vehicle-mounted maintenance after fully understanding to data Equipment tool repairs railway in real time, is detected again by rear car to railway after maintenance, whether Measuring error is thorough.
Working method two: orbital maintenance vehicle is used alone
After obtaining railway by defect-detecting equipment and damaging message, orbital maintenance personnel will need the maintenance of equipment tool used It after being put into vehicle, then goes at impaired railway and work is repaired to rail, will be tieed up after the completion of maintenance by car-mounted computer It repairs situation and is sent to railway maintenance control centre.
Working method three: intelligent track inspection car is used alone
Flaw detection trolley can be used alone, the damage situations of energy automatic Pilot and automatic detection track, and can will test The information information receiving end mouth of remote transmission to railway maintenance control centre and maintenance car by way of wireless transmission.

The utility model is further described below with reference to intelligent track inspection car Functional Design.
The replaceable function of inner part:
Intelligent vehicle can be opened from side and below, also be provided convenience for maintenance work, interior battery and water The size of case be it is standardized, can replace after use, embody Green design concept.
Flaw detection function:
Damage check is carried out to rail using ultrasonic examination mode, probe uses wheel seach unit.Carrying out flaw detection task In the process, damaged rails are found, is marked with airbrush at impaired place, gives intuitive visual signal.
Store function:
The collection mode for using for reference Other Engineering vehicle, by primary structure used in flaw detection when not carrying out flaw detection work It is stowed to underbody seat, avoids excessive damage.
Laser range finder:
The 3D topographic map within 200 meters around can be accurately drawn out in time and is uploaded to vehicle-mounted computer maincenter.Moulding It is blended with overall structure, has embodied technology sense.
Video camera:
To detect traffic lights and pedestrian, cycling person, vehicle driving route on the mobile barrier that meets with Hinder;And railway surface and surrounding picture can be recorded in real time.
Trailer-mounted radar:
Each trailer-mounted radar in front and back is responsible for the fixation roadblock of detection remotely, avoids occurring during automatic running It is unexpected, improve the sense of security that product uses
